Description

A=Bodice; B=Skirt. Blue, brown & cream pinstriped silk twill. Bodice (A) standing band collar w/ cream silk liner; false lapels; brown silk twill pleated placket covers center button closure (18 buttons). Peplum pointed front & back w/ pleats lined w/ brown silk; long fitted sleeves w/ turned back cuffs trimmed w/ brown silk ruching & white liner (same as at collar). Boned; lined w/ brown striped ticking; woven waistband w/ hook & eye. Skirt (B) pulled up & pleated at sides to reveal underskirt; underskirt is poufed/ bustled at back. Has pleated dust ruffle; pocket on right side; lined w/ brown cotton; boned bar across back & cotton tape tie to hold bustle style. Hem lined w/ windowpane buckram & black wool; bound w/ green wool tape.
